Braces, surgery, a night guard or can I get my teeth pulled and … WebDec 29, 2024 · Most patients will need to wear their braces for between 18 to 30 months. The older you are and the more complicated your spacing issue, the longer you will need to wear your braces. You will also need to wear a retainer for a few months up to two years to keep tissues aligned.

Traditional braces require an orthodontist to place … WebAug 13, 2024 · For braces, the American Association of Orthodontists (AAO) recommends that children first see an orthodontist at age seven. This is because, by this age, most children have a mix of baby teeth and adult teeth, and some permanent teeth may have already come in, which makes it easier for the orthodontist to assess any problems.

WebApr 10, 2024 · Summary. Avoid eating popcorn while you have braces. The hard kernel and the hull of the popcorn kernel can damage your braces, hurt your teeth, and cause infection in your gums. Snacking alternatives for popcorn include soft crackers, veggie sticks, fruit, and cheese.
